American Girl is a line of dolls by Mattel that were created to help build self-confidence and pride in themselves.  The dolls are all unique, allowing girls to pick a doll that matches their interests.  Each doll is approximately 18 inches tall.  There are several lines of dolls, one of each is based on characters in history.  Each of these dolls comes with a book focused on numerous topics including child labor, racism and war.  The dolls have become so popular with young girls, there are now stores that allow purchase clothing, accessories and dolls themselves directly.  Each American Girl Place also offers a cafe, allowing seating for dolls and miniature-sized tea sets. Because of the popularity, American Girl has expanded to a full line of books, magazines and movies.

Stats:

Dolls are approximately 18 inches tall, except the Bitty line, which stands at approximately 15 inches tall.

Each doll includes a book, accessories and additonal books/movies sold seperately.

Recommended for girls aged 3 and up.
